Mountain Splendour
Snow leopards look at snow all day!
It's here, there, everywhere!
It hardly ever goes away!
It's white beyond compare!
It's dazzling white, it's total white,
It really, really is!
It's safe to say that it's too bright!
It's not something they'd miss...
Snow leopards sit the whole day long
On snow, snow, snow, snow, snow...
It's sometimes nice, don't get me wrong,
But doesn't that stuff glow! ?
It's freezing cold, no good at all...
And bores them all to tears...
They hate it when new snowflakes fall
And tickle both their ears!
Snow leopards wait for food to eat...
They wait, wait, wait, wait, wait...
They take things slow, they tap their feet...
And think life's just great!
They can't hum tunes like humans do...
Remembering each rhyme...
They just sit down, enjoy the view...
And... while... away... the... time...
Denis Martindale, copyright, November 2010.
The poem is based on the magnificent painting
by Stephen Gayford called 'Mountain Splendour II'.
